Which
fast food restaurants are best for dieters?
Don't count out fast
food restaurants while dieting because most have
something that you can enjoy on their menu that
is low in fat and calories.
With more and more
individuals seeking to drop pounds, fast food restaurants
are scrambling to meet their needs. For too long,
the fast food industry has driven the Food Selections
for the public and slowly as more and more individuals
face obesity and health woes related to such, the
public is demanding a turnaround. In other words,
'Give us what we need rather than what we want or
you'll not be getting my business anymore.' Fact
is, it's very difficult to resist the unhealthy
versions of fast food because they taste so darn
good.
With this said, our
top choice when dining out has to be Subway. Their
sandwiches are not only low in fat and calories,
they are delicious. And they give the customer of
making their low fat sandwich any way that they
want - and it still ends up low in fat and calories
due to the healthy ingredients offered.
Taco Bell also offers
some tasty reprieves for the wandering dieter such
as their Original Taco and Soft Taco - both weighing
in at under 200 calories. And if you ask, they'll
be happy to provide a nutrition guide before you
order.
Another fast food
restaurant that holds good eats for dieters is McDonald's.
Their salads reign king - just watch the salad dressing,
croutons and crackers. They too will provide a nutrition
guide before taking your order.
